【javascript – jQuery生成唯一ID】教程文章相关的互联网学习教程文章

JavaScript-jQuery05# jQuery 事件操作【代码】【图】

jQuery 事件操作 jquert动态操作事件直接上代码 <script type="text/javascript">//js绑定事件function testJsBind(){var btn1 = document.getElementById("btn1");btn1.onclick=function(){alert("我是js绑定事件");}}//jquery绑定事件function testBind(){var btn2 = $("#btn2");btn2.bind("click",function(){alert("我是jquery绑定事件");});btn2.bind("click",function(){alert("我是jquery绑定事件2");});}//测试Onefunction...

JavaScript-jQuery04【代码】

jQuery操作元素内容,样式 操做内容获取对象名.html()//返回当前对象中的所有内容,包括HTML标签 对象名.text()//返回当前对象中所有的文本内容修改对象名.html(“新的内容”)//新的内容会将原有的标签覆盖,HTML标签会被解析执行 对象名.text(“新的内容”)//新的内容会将原有的内容覆盖,html标签以文本格式显示<script src="js/jquery.min.js" type="text/javascript" charset="utf-8"></script><script type="text/javascript"...

javascript-jQuery-ui滑块-如何阻止两个滑块相互控制【代码】

这是参考先前询问的question 这里的问题是,每个滑块控制另一个.它导致反馈. 我怎么可能停止它?$(function() {$("#slider").slider({ slide: moveSlider2 });$("#slider1").slider({ slide: moveSlider1 });function moveSlider2( e, ui ) {$('#slider1').slider( 'moveTo', Math.round(ui.value) );}function moveSlider1( e, ui ) {$('#slider').slider( 'moveTo', Math.round(ui.value) );} });解决方法:这有点像hack,但可以:$...

javascript-jQuery Sortable回调不起作用?【代码】

我正在使用jQuery UI的Sortable组件.即使进行了此简单测试,回调也似乎根本不起作用:<script type="text/javascript" src="jquery-1.3.js"></script> <script type="text/javascript" src="jquery-ui-personalized-1.6rc4.js"></script> <script type="text/javascript"> $(document).ready(function () {$("#outer").sortable({start: function (e, ui) {alert("started");},update: function (e, ui) {alert("updated");}}); });...

javascript-jQuery悬停,图像映射,循环和数组【代码】

我想将jQuery悬停方法用于包含多个奇数形状的基本区域图像地图上方的鼠标悬停,以便在每个确切的形状上悬停都会触发图像交换,以及在单独的文本块中进行.innerhtml交换.我从完全透明的占位符“零”图像开始,然后在过渡时交换到实时图像地图区域上方的png,然后在过渡时返回到零图像. 因此,一个区域地图区域的代码如下所示.这里,areamapImage1对应于基本图像的坐标区域.$('#areamapImage1').hover(function() {$('#imageSwap').attr('s...

javascript-jQuery ui.slider:添加click事件以显示/隐藏句柄【代码】

我对javascript和jquery完全陌生.我的编程知识不存在.几天前,我才刚开始做一些简单的任务,例如替换CSS类或切换div.因此,我想在这里问新手问题,以示对自己的脚步表示歉意.但我希望有人能帮助我解决我的问题. 我需要为调查实施某种视觉模拟量表; ui.slider非常适合那个.但我需要默认情况下隐藏该句柄.当用户单击滑块时,手柄应出现在正确的位置.这应该非常简单-至少我希望如此-只需用css隐藏手柄并通过滑块上的click事件对其进行更改...

可以从javascript / jquery返回返回网址吗?

我有一个问题,当用户在我的网站上超时时,他们仍然登录.因此,他们仍然可以执行ajax请求.如果他们在我的网站上发出ajax请求,我的asp.net mvc授权标签将阻止此操作. 然后,如果授权失败,则授权通常会将用户重定向回登录页面. 现在,由于这是一个ajax请求,因此似乎正在发生的事情是它将整个页面发送回呈现为html.因此,由于我只是将整个页面作为html发送给我,因此用户永远不会获得重定向. 但是firebug在控制台中这样说: http:// localho...

javascript-jQuery-我可以动态更改父元素吗?一个新元素并将其设为选择的父项?【代码】

我有一个div #someDiv,我可以创建一个新元素并使#someDiv成为其子级吗?基本上,我想包装一个新的元素#someDiv.我该怎么做呢?$("#someDiv").appendTo($("<div id='newParent'></div>")); // The intent is to move #someDiv into the new container // The new container may or may not be in the same // position in the DOM as #someDiv感谢您的提示! 干杯,?ck在圣地亚哥解决方法: $("#something").wrap("<div id='newParen...

JavaScript / JQuery:在变量名中使用$(this)【代码】

我正在编写一个jquery-plugin,它会更改某些用户操作上某些元素的css值.在其他操作上,应将css值重置为其初始值. 由于找不到恢复初始css值的方法,因此我刚刚创建了一个数组,该数组将所有初始值存储在开头. 我这样做是:var initialCSSValue = new Array()在我的插件的开头和之后的某个设置循环中,我使用的所有元素都被访问了initialCSSValue[$(this)] = parseInt($(this).css('<CSS-attribute>'));这在Firefox中效果很好.但是,我刚刚...

javascript-jQuery live确认【代码】

我在使用.live()进行确认时遇到问题.每次点击都会增加确认对话框.我知道.die(),但我无法使用它.$("button.del").live("click", function(){if(!confirm("Are you sure?")) {//close}});我试过$(“ button.del”).die(“ click”);在上述代码之后,在这种情况下,甚至不会触发该confim.解决方法:如果仅自己运行该代码,对话框是否会多次出现? 如果对话框出现多次,则可能的解释是您不小心多次运行了此.live()绑定.如果发生这种情况,则每...

javascript-jQuery cookie设置在页面刷新后选择下拉值【代码】

老实说,今天我走了这么远后,我的脑子反而被炸了. 我正在尝试使用此插件在页面上保存多个选择下拉菜单的状态: http://plugins.jquery.com/project/cookies 我正在使用此jQuery根据其ID为不同的标题下拉列表设置Cookie:$(document).ready(function() {// hide 'Other' inputs to start $('.jOther').hide();// event listener on all select drop downs with class of jTitle $(".jTitle").change(function(){//set the select va...

javascript-jQuery查找图像的高度,即使未在HTML中设置【代码】

我有一个奇怪的问题.我正在运行一个简单的查询,该查询在页面上找到最大的图像.这是一些测试数据-所有图片均为3232,但其中一张图片的尺寸为300300.<img src="app/assets/images/icons/blue.png" /> <img src="app/assets/images/icons/error.png"/> <img src="app/assets/images/icons/info.png" height="300" width="300"/>如果我运行像这样的简单查询:$('img').each(function(){console.log($(this).height());});我将得到0,0,30...

javascript-为什么jQuery .load()触发两次?【代码】

我正在将jQuery 1.4与jQuery History结合使用,并试图弄清为什么Firebug / Web Inspector在每个页面加载时显示2个XHR GET请求(访问我的网站首页(/或/#)时,该请求数量是原来的两倍). 例如在启用Firebug的情况下访问this(或任何)页面. 这是已编辑/相关的代码(请参见full source):-$(document).ready(function() {$('body').delegate('a', 'click', function(e) {var hash = this.href; if (hash.indexOf(window.location.hostname) >...

javascript-Jquery .each():查找包含输入的元素【代码】

我有一张桌子,里面有一个thead部分和一个tbody部分.我每个人都使用jQuery查找并计算表中的所有TH.这很好.但是同时我想检查tbody中TH的TD是否包含任何输入元素. 这是我到目前为止的内容:jQuery('#' + _target).each(function () {var $table = jQuery(this);var i = 0;jQuery('th', $table).each(function (column) {if (jQuery(this).find("input")) {dataTypes[i] = { "sSortDataType": "input" }}else {dataTypes[i] = { "sSort...

javascript-通过JQuery在点击时显示一堆图像-有任何简便的动画方法吗?【代码】

这是我正在使用的(非常简单的)JS代码:$(document).ready(function() {$(".button-list .next").click(function() {project = $(this).parents().filter(".projektweb").eq(0);currentimg = project.find(".images-list li.current");nextimg = currentimg.next();firstimg = project.find(".images-list li:first");currentimg.removeClass("current");if (nextimg.is("li")) nextimg.addClass("current");else firstimg.addClass...